7384  Bitcoin / Press / Re: [2018-12-03]Crypto Mining Malware has Become a New Way of Tricking Innocent User on: December 03, 2018, 08:59:14 PM

I don't understand. How's buying Monero or other privacy-focused altcoins can be dangerous? Also, how do they install malware on crypto mining machines?
No, they don't but there are some malware that can steal your CPU usage and use for mining XMR. Some website could also steal your CPU usage every time you visit the site same as the pirate bay website.

And one more question, as long we are talking about this. Until recently there was was this message on the front page of The Pirate Bay:




But it is not there anymore. Does it mean they have stopped mining XMR or they have just decided to not warn you?

Old pirate bay has seized by FBI  that I think the original website is no longer work. There are many TPB clones which I think still have this script in their own website if you don't have adblocker or mining blocker in your chrome or firefox the script will steal your CPU usage and mine XMR. So if you don't experience high CPU usage your desktop or laptop when accessing the clone piratebay it means that they don't have this mining script and maybe it is another clone of other piratebay websites that don't know how to put the mining script in their own website.

7390  Other / Beginners & Help / Re: Half of all Phishing Sites Now Have the Padlock Sign on: December 02, 2018, 06:21:00 PM
They can buy cheap SSL in some hosting sites pretty easily these days and they can make phishing sites without giving their real information or they can use a whois guard to protect their information and I think they can also make a prepaid VISA or Master card without KYC and use it to buy a domain and hosting with fake info.

I remembered the news before about apple.com that hackers make a domain name the same as apple.com using a Punycode and lots of people victim with this phishing site before.

That is why we always need to keep checking the URL if the character is correct because there are some phishing site URL looks the same as the original site and always make sure that don't use or should not use the same password as you use in your email or don't give your real information without scanning it using virustotal.
